What Are the Key Features to Look for in Women’s Waterproof Winter Boots?

When searching for the best women’s waterproof winter boot, several key features are essential to ensure warmth, comfort, and durability.

  • Waterproof Material: The outer material of the boot should be made from waterproof leather or synthetic materials that prevent moisture from entering. Look for boots with sealed seams and waterproof membranes to enhance protection against snow and slush.
  • Insulation: Insulation is crucial for keeping feet warm in cold temperatures. Materials like Thinsulate or fleece provide excellent thermal insulation while keeping the boots lightweight and flexible.
  • Traction Outsole: A good winter boot should have a rubber outsole with deep treads to provide excellent grip on slippery surfaces. This is particularly important for preventing slips and falls on ice and snow.
  • Comfort and Fit: The boots should have a comfortable fit with adequate arch support and cushioning. Look for options with adjustable features, like laces or buckles, to ensure a snug fit that accommodates thick socks.
  • Height and Coverage: Consider the height of the boot, as taller boots provide more coverage and protection against snow. Mid-calf or knee-high boots are often preferred in deep snow conditions.
  • Breathability: While waterproofing is essential, breathability should not be overlooked. Look for boots that allow moisture from sweat to escape, which helps keep feet dry and comfortable during prolonged wear.
  • Weight: Lightweight boots are preferable for ease of movement, especially if you plan on wearing them for extended periods. Heavy boots can cause fatigue and discomfort during outdoor activities.

How Do Insulation and Waterproofing Impact Comfort and Performance?

Waterproofing is achieved through various technologies, such as Gore-Tex or rubber overlays, which block external moisture while allowing internal vapor to escape. This feature is vital for maintaining foot comfort, especially in snow or slush, where wet conditions can lead to cold, uncomfortable feet.

Breathability ensures that while the boot keeps water out, it also allows for the release of perspiration, preventing the build-up of moisture that can lead to discomfort or coldness. A well-designed boot balances insulation and waterproofing with breathability to keep feet dry and warm during prolonged wear.

The weight of insulation and waterproofing materials can impact how agile and comfortable a user feels while wearing the boots. Lightweight materials can enhance performance, especially for activities like hiking or walking in snowy conditions.

Fit is another critical aspect that can be affected by insulation. A boot that is too tight due to excessive insulation may restrict circulation, leading to cold feet, while a well-fitted boot with appropriate insulation allows for warmth without compromising comfort. The best women’s waterproof winter boots will strike a balance that accommodates various foot shapes and sizes.

Which Materials Provide the Best Protection Against Weather Conditions?

The best materials for women’s waterproof winter boots offer durability, insulation, and weather resistance.

  • Gore-Tex: Gore-Tex is a well-known waterproof and breathable membrane that is often used in high-quality winter boots. It prevents water from entering while allowing moisture from sweat to escape, keeping feet dry and comfortable in cold, wet conditions.
  • Leather: Full-grain leather is highly durable and naturally water-resistant, making it an excellent choice for winter boots. When treated with a waterproofing agent, leather can effectively repel water while providing warmth and insulation.
  • Rubber: Rubber is inherently waterproof and is often used in the outer soles and uppers of winter boots. It provides excellent traction on slippery surfaces, ensuring stability and safety in icy conditions.
  • Synthetic Insulation: Materials like Thinsulate and PrimaLoft offer lightweight insulation without adding bulk. These synthetic insulations trap heat while allowing moisture to escape, keeping feet warm and dry even in freezing temperatures.
  • Nylon: High-denier nylon is often used in combination with other materials to create lightweight, waterproof boots. It is resistant to abrasion and can be treated to enhance its waterproof qualities, making it suitable for various weather conditions.

What Care Techniques Maintain Waterproof Features?

Proper care techniques are essential to maintain the waterproof features of winter boots.

  • Regular Cleaning: Keeping your boots clean prevents dirt and grime from breaking down the waterproof materials. Use a soft brush or cloth to remove debris, and use mild soap and water for deeper cleaning to ensure the waterproof membranes remain effective.
  • Waterproofing Treatments: Applying a waterproofing spray or treatment after cleaning helps restore and enhance the boot’s water resistance. Look for products specifically designed for the material of your boots, whether they are leather, synthetic, or fabric.
  • Drying Properly: Avoid direct heat sources like radiators or hair dryers when drying wet boots, as excessive heat can damage waterproof membranes. Instead, allow them to air dry at room temperature and stuff them with newspaper to absorb moisture and maintain shape.
  • Storage Practices: Store your boots in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ight to prevent materials from degrading. Using boot trees or stuffing them with paper can help maintain their shape and prevent creasing.
  • Inspecting for Damage: Regularly check for signs of wear and tear, such as cracks or delamination, which can compromise waterproofing. Addressing any damage promptly, whether through repairs or replacements, ensures your boots continue to perform well in wet conditions.

How Should You Clean and Store Your Boots for Longevity?

To ensure the longevity of your boots, it is essential to clean and store them properly. Here are some effective methods:

  • Regular Cleaning: Remove dirt and debris after each use to prevent buildup.
  • Use Appropriate Cleaners: Select cleaners specifically designed for the material of your boots, whether leather, synthetic, or fabric.
  • Drying Techniques: Always let your boots dry naturally away from direct heat sources, which can damage materials.
  • Conditioning Leather: For leather boots, apply a conditioner periodically to maintain suppleness and prevent cracking.
  • Proper Storage: Store boots in a cool, dry place, ideally in their original box or a dust bag to protect them from light and dust.
  • Use Boot Trees or Stuffing: Utilize boot trees or stuff them with newspaper to retain shape and absorb moisture.

Regular cleaning helps maintain the appearance and integrity of your boots. After each wear, brush off any dirt or mud with a soft brush and wipe them down with a damp cloth. This simple step prevents grime from becoming embedded in the material.

Using appropriate cleaners tailored to your boots’ material is crucial. For leather, a specialized leather cleaner can lift stains without stripping away essential oils, while synthetic materials often require a gentle detergent to avoid damage.

Drying techniques are vital for maintaining the structure of your boots. Avoid placing them near radiators or in direct sunlight, as excessive heat can warp the material and cause it to crack, especially in leather boots.

Conditioning leather boots is equally important, as it helps to keep them flexible and prevents them from drying out. A good leather conditioner should be applied every few months, or more frequently if the boots are exposed to harsh conditions.

Proper storage is essential for preventing damage during off-seasons. Keeping your boots in a cool, dry area protects them from humidity and temperature fluctuations that can cause warping or mold.

Using boot trees or stuffing is a great way to maintain the shape of your boots. Boot trees help prevent creasing, while newspaper or other stuffing materials can absorb moisture, ensuring that your boots remain fresh and in good condition.
